Transaction ecac03c0a5a618c70eab40a4cc7dabf4add0832b7c2d5a502cc01a3c1766be7f
1 Input
1 Output
-
ecac03c0a5a618c70eab40a4cc7dabf4add0832b7c2d5a502cc01a3c1766be7f:0
- value
- 1504207
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 805c21c2ec553f56f78f582fa91ba9cbf8a89a4e OP_EQUAL
- address
- 3DPinXtPBQmnTVasNN16E6ehHVnPRNnqhR